We covered three different types of confidence intervals:

One-sample Z-interval: ¯x±Zcσ/n, where σ is the population standard deviation (when it is known).

One-sample T-interval:¯x±Tcs/n, where s is the sample standard deviation.

Two-sample T-interval:(¯x1¯x2)±Tc⋅{(s1squared/n1)+(s2squared/n2)}, where we use the sample statistics from two independent samples.

Convert a sample mean X-bar into a z-score: Z=(¯xμ)/(σ/n)
